What does Probi do?

Probi AB is a Swedish company that specializes in the development and production of probiotic products. Founded in 1991 as a spin-off from Lund Institute of Technology, Probi is now represented in Sweden, the USA, and India with approximately 200 employees. The business model of Probi is based on research and development of probiotic bacterial cultures, as well as marketing probiotic products developed in collaboration with customers and partners. The company's business divisions are divided into probiotic products and research and development. Probiotic products: Probi produces a wide range of probiotic products, including dietary supplements, functional foods, animal feed, and medical devices. These products contain live microorganisms intended to support gut health and strengthen the immune system. Probi works closely with customers and partners to develop tailored solutions. Research and development: An important part of Probi's business is the research and development of probiotic bacterial cultures. Research findings serve as the basis for new products and applications. Probi has its own research department equipped with state-of-the-art laboratory technologies. In addition, Probi collaborates closely with partners from the academic and industrial sectors to explore new technologies and applications. Probi's history originally began in the 1980s at Lund Institute of Technology in Sweden, where the foundation for the development of probiotics was laid. In 1991, Probi was established as a spin-off from the institute, initially focusing on research and development of probiotic bacterial cultures. Over the following years, the company expanded internationally and developed more and more products and applications. Today, Probi is a leading global provider of probiotic products and solutions. Probi's products include probiotic capsules and tablets, probiotic yogurts, beverages, and dietary supplements. These products are intended to stabilize gut flora and strengthen the immune system. Additionally, Probi offers animal feed with probiotic bacterial cultures to promote the health of livestock. An important aspect of Probi is its collaboration with partners and customers. Through these partnerships, innovative products and solutions are developed to meet the needs of customers. Probi works closely with the food industry, healthcare sector, and animal feed industry. The future of Probi looks promising. The company aims to continue developing innovative products and solutions to promote the health of humans and animals. Stock savings plans offer an attractive way for investors to build wealth over the long term. One of the main advantages is the so-called cost-average effect: by regularly investing a fixed amount in stocks or stock funds, you automatically buy more shares when prices are low, and fewer when they are high. This can lead to a more favorable average price per share over time. In addition, stock savings plans allow small investors access to expensive stocks, as they can participate with small amounts. Regular investment also promotes a disciplined investment strategy and helps to avoid emotional decisions, such as impulsive buying or selling. Furthermore, investors benefit from the potential appreciation of the stocks as well as from dividend distributions, which can be reinvested, enhancing the compounding effect and thus the growth of the invested capital.
